TwitterAPI.ActivityView: Ignore unhandled activities

This commit is contained in:
href 2018-12-14 17:24:33 +01:00
parent 30dc81667c
commit 84b9a9d497
No known key found for this signature in database
GPG key ID: EE8296C1A152C325

View file

@ -14,6 +14,7 @@ defmodule Pleroma.Web.TwitterAPI.ActivityView do
alias Pleroma.HTML alias Pleroma.HTML
import Ecto.Query import Ecto.Query
require Logger
defp query_context_ids([]), do: [] defp query_context_ids([]), do: []
@ -276,6 +277,11 @@ defmodule Pleroma.Web.TwitterAPI.ActivityView do
} }
end end
def render("activity.json", %{activity: unhandled_activity}) do
Logger.warn("#{__MODULE__} unhandled activity: #{inspect(unhandled_activity)}")
nil
end
def render_content(%{"type" => "Note"} = object) do def render_content(%{"type" => "Note"} = object) do
summary = object["summary"] summary = object["summary"]